Transaction 6872ebfd75006410370b2ea8b7a5aff251d5823e2b0b60574ecae1b643cf5f31

1 Input
2 Outputs
  • 6872ebfd75006410370b2ea8b7a5aff251d5823e2b0b60574ecae1b643cf5f31:0
  • value  767124
    address  3QFAyQGtgk7BicfimJCGCookDDAR7Rn7j6
  • 6872ebfd75006410370b2ea8b7a5aff251d5823e2b0b60574ecae1b643cf5f31:1
  • value  2838152
    address  1BRqu2vhSL75N9tVuwk36YNbPrUPjmj3bY